Strengths: Stiffness, Durability, 'holding of speed,' hubsWeaknesses: 300 grams heavier than a Zipp disc.Bottom Line: Great disc wheel. There may be lighter disc wheels out there, but few can old a candle to the comete. For one, tis is the most durable wheel out there. Mine is 5 years old and runs like it is new. The bearins are great. It is super stiff. And although the concept of a heavy wheel 'holding its speed' may be scientific gibberish, it sure feels like it hold its speed, and since time trialling is 1/2 mental, I count this as a plus. As for the weight...deal. I think this is the best disc wheel money can buy today.
